Villa Serapide B&B is a Tivoli, IT base that suits travelers who want to mix quiet downtime with fast access to the town’s most famous Roman-era sights. Customer feedback commonly highlights the welcoming, personal feel of the stay, with guests appreciating the calm atmosphere and the way hosts help them plan days around Tivoli’s landmarks. Reviews also mention the practicality of the location for sightseeing, especially for visitors who want to pair Villa d’Este’s gardens with Hadrian’s Villa without spending the whole day in transit. In the area around Villa Serapide B&B, you can reach Villa d’Este in about 6 km and Hadrian’s Villa in roughly 5 km, while the Rocca Pia area is around 6 km away for panoramic views over the valley. For a change of pace, Tivoli Waterfalls are typically about 7 km from the property, giving you a scenic outing that feels removed from the bustle.

Villa d’Este is approximately 6 km from Villa Serapide B&B. This makes it a realistic day plan if you’re comfortable with short transfers and then walking through the gardens and fountains at your own pace.
Hadrian’s Villa (Villa Adriana) is about 5 km from Villa Serapide B&B. Many travelers pair it with Villa d’Este in the same trip window, since both are among Tivoli’s best-known landmarks.
Villa Serapide B&B is best for travelers who plan a mix of local walking and short transfers. The historic centre and viewpoints like Rocca Pia are roughly 6 km away, so walking is most practical for portions of the day rather than everything.
Rome Ciampino Airport is about 36 km away and Rome Fiumicino Airport is around 47 km. These are typical driving distances for the region, so travelers should factor in time for traffic and transfers.
